From f68063afbc294b5f7ab672a12e45e335ad6796d5 Mon Sep 17 00:00:00 2001 From: kwryankrattiger <80296582+kwryankrattiger@users.noreply.github.com> Date: Wed, 14 Jun 2023 11:02:18 -0500 Subject: DaV: Drop propagation of HDF5 to darshan (#38361) Darshan Runtime does not properly link symols for HDF5 when using shared libraries. --- var/spack/repos/builtin/packages/ecp-data-vis-sdk/package.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/var/spack/repos/builtin/packages/ecp-data-vis-sdk/package.py b/var/spack/repos/builtin/packages/ecp-data-vis-sdk/package.py index fc0f7f22b1..fff2512821 100644 --- a/var/spack/repos/builtin/packages/ecp-data-vis-sdk/package.py +++ b/var/spack/repos/builtin/packages/ecp-data-vis-sdk/package.py @@ -107,7 +107,7 @@ class EcpDataVisSdk(BundlePackage, CudaPackage, ROCmPackage): propagate=["cuda", "hdf5", "sz", "zfp", "fortran"] + cuda_arch_variants, ) - dav_sdk_depends_on("darshan-runtime+mpi", when="+darshan", propagate=["hdf5"]) + dav_sdk_depends_on("darshan-runtime+mpi", when="+darshan") dav_sdk_depends_on("darshan-util", when="+darshan") dav_sdk_depends_on("faodel+shared+mpi network=libfabric", when="+faodel", propagate=["hdf5"]) -- cgit v1.2.3-70-g09d2